Doom (Series) Alternatives

Doom is described as 'Science fiction horror-themed first-person shooter video game in which players assume the role of a space marine, popularly known as "Doomguy", who must fight his way through the hordes of invading demons from Hell' and is a popular first-person shooter in the games category. There are more than 50 games similar to Doom for a variety of platforms, including Windows, Linux, Mac, Steam and Playstation apps. The best Doom alternative is Half-Life. It's not free, so if you're looking for a free alternative, you could try Xonotic or AssaultCube. Other Doom like games are Quake, Fallout, Borderlands and Prodeus.
